In this episode, we will dive into the world of Jason Moss - a man who was penpals with John Wayne Gacy, Richard Ramirez, Jeffrey Dahmer, Charles Manson, Henry Lee Lucas, and Elmer Wayne Henley. Jason Moss was a dedicated criminal defense lawyer who worked with the Secret Service & the FBI, helping law enforcement decipher between those who were insane, and those who were pretending. Jason Moss killed himself on June 6th, 2006 - that's right, on 6/6/06. His relationships with each serial killer and popular figure were crafted in the way that painted him as their ideal victim, reeling them in and exposing their secrets - mainly, John Wayne Gacy, who he corresponded with multiple times a week at the young age of 18 years old. Jason Moss's story is long but extremely vivid, traumatizing, and triggering - all of which he discussed in his book "The Last Victim."
